Hiking around gmina Wielopole Skrzyńskie is characterized by its location within the Strzyżów Foothills and the Czarnorzeki-Strzyżów Landscape Park. The terrain features rolling hills, extensive forests, and valleys, providing a diverse environment for outdoor activities. This region offers a mix of easy paths and moderate trails, suitable for various hiking abilities.

Bardo (534 m above sea level) is a peak in the Czarnorzecko-Strzyżowski Landscape Park. There are three trails running through here: the yellow Three Foothills Trail, the blue Dębica - Kamieniec Castle and the green Ropczyce - Bardo. The peak is forested, so it does not offer any views, but there is a wooden bench here if we want to rest.

Kamienna Góra (477 m above sea level) is a peak in the Czarnorzecko-Strzyżowski Landscape Park. From this place you can enjoy a beautiful panorama.

There are over 35 hiking routes recorded in gmina Wielopole Skrzyńskie, offering a variety of experiences within the Strzyżów Foothills and the Czarnorzeki-Strzyżów Landscape Park.
The terrain in gmina Wielopole Skrzyńskie is characterized by rolling hills, extensive forests, and picturesque valleys, typical of the Strzyżów Foothills. You'll find a mix of easy paths and moderate trails, with some significant elevation changes, especially around observation points.
Yes, gmina Wielopole Skrzyńskie offers several easy trails. A good option for a shorter, less strenuous walk is the Educational trail "Wielki Las" (loop), which is 1.6 miles (2.5 km) long and leads through forested areas. There are 13 easy routes in total.
Hikers can explore several natural reserves and historical sites. The Herby Nature Reserve and Wielki Las Nature Reserve are popular for their natural beauty. Additionally, the Stępina Railway Bunker offers a unique historical point of interest.
Yes, many trails in gmina Wielopole Skrzyńskie are designed as loops. For example, the Pętla Stępina - Bardo - Kamienna Góra is a moderate circular route that takes you through the Czarnorzeki-Strzyżów Landscape Park.

Yes, the region features observation towers (wieża widokowa), including the 'Krzyż III Tysiąclecia i wieża widokowa' (Cross of the Third Millennium and observation tower). These towers are often accessible via hiking trails and provide panoramic views of the surrounding countryside, making them rewarding destinations for hikers.
The Strzyżów Foothills and Czarnorzeki-Strzyżów Landscape Park are beautiful throughout the warmer months, from spring to autumn, when the forests are lush and the weather is generally pleasant for hiking. Spring brings blooming flora, while autumn offers vibrant fall foliage. Winter hiking is also possible, but requires appropriate gear for snow and ice.
While most routes are moderate in length, some trails offer longer excursions. For instance, the Pętla Stępina - Bardo - Kamienna Góra covers over 12 km, providing a more extended hiking experience within the scenic landscape park.
Information on specific public transport links directly to trailheads is limited. However, as a rural gmina, local bus services might connect to some villages near trail starting points. It's advisable to check local transport schedules for the most up-to-date information when planning your trip.
While not directly within Wielopole Skrzyńskie, the nearby Prządki Nature Reserve, located within the broader Czarnorzeki-Strzyżów Landscape Park, is famous for its unique rock formations, such as the Prządka-Baba Rock Formation. This area is easily accessible from the gmina and offers a fascinating geological experience.
